What is Cable One

Overview

Cable One is the former name of the US-based residential internet and cable provider now operating mainly as Sparklight in the United States.

The company provides internet, TV and phone services in selected US markets; it is not a local Nigerian provider.

Brand names and scope

Cable One is often referred to alongside the brand Sparklight, which is used for consumer-facing services and support.

Because Cable One/Sparklight does not have an operating presence in Nigeria, local customers in Nigeria will not normally have active accounts with this company.

How to cancel Cable One

Online cancellation

  • Log in to your Cable One / Sparklight account if you have one and look for an account or service cancellation option.
  • If an online cancellation option is not visible, use the support/contact section to request cancellation in writing through the support portal.

Phone or email cancellation

  • Call Cable One / Sparklight customer service: 1-877-692-2253 (use +1 prefix from outside the US).
  • You can also contact support via the provider's help email or support site; request confirmation in writing and include your account details.

Key steps summary

  • Prepare account number and personal identification.
  • Request cancellation and ask for a confirmation number or email.
  • Confirm the service end date and any outstanding balance.

What happens when you cancel

Service access

After cancellation is requested, services typically continue until the end of the current billing cycle.

You should expect access to internet or TV services to remain active through the paid period unless otherwise specified by the provider.

Billing and final charges

Outstanding balances remain payable after cancellation and will be billed according to your account terms.

Any credits or final charges are normally reconciled on a final bill; confirm whether you must return equipment to avoid additional fees.

Will I get a refund?

General policy

Cable One allows cancellation at any time but does not guarantee refunds for partial billing periods or prepayments.

Users are generally responsible for any outstanding balances and typically receive service until the end of the billing cycle.

Possible exceptions and actions

  • If your bill was charged in error or there is a billing dispute, contact customer service and request an investigation.
  • If you believe you qualify for a refund, ask for a written decision and follow formal dispute or chargeback procedures if required.
  • There is no clear indication of a statutory 14-day refund right for Cable One in the available sources.

Common mistakes

Not checking the billing cycle

A frequent error is cancelling without confirming the billing cycle end date and expecting an immediate refund.

Services commonly continue until the end of the paid period, so plan cancellations to minimise overlap or extra charges.

Failing to get written confirmation

Another common mistake is relying on verbal confirmation only; always request a written confirmation or reference number.

Without written proof it can be harder to dispute continued billing or to prove the date you requested cancellation.
